Bottom Line Property Management LLC, Charlotte, NC is a full and complete-service realty company. They have been in business over 30 years. They also manage properties within the greater Charlotte region, Gastonia, Concord and Rock Hill. The company not only manages property but also sells and brokers properties. Their sales staff are knowledgeable and pleasant, making the whole process easy.
